Handover — Skiffler autoscaler (from Drev, to whoever picks this up)

Hey plugin folks — I'm rotating off the Skiffler queue-depth autoscaler, so quick brain dump. Scaling decisions key off the depth metric your plugins emit; if you report stale depths, Skiffler will happily scale to zero and strand jobs, so keep the heartbeat under 30s. The new hysteresis window is configurable per plugin now — see the Copperbight docs. One last thing: the admin console for tuning thresholds is sealed, and it opens with the recovery passphrase below.

strongbox words: gilok-druion-briath-wendor-briion-prawyn-fenion-oliir-casdor-holius-briius-gilath-gilael-pelys

Pool Cars — Night Shift Basics

Key cabinet: rear corridor, next to the plant room at Orlick Depot. Take a fob, log it on the clipboard, return it before 06:00. Report damage or low fuel in the shift book. No personal use. Cabinet locks itself after each use. Open it with the code below.

door code, yagap-bahof: bdg-O-05

Before your first shift, confirm you can reach the scheduler dashboard and the valve-controller admin panel. If the scheduler daemon loses its encrypted state file, misting cycles in the greenhouse wing will halt silently, so check the heartbeat log every morning. Recovery requires re-seeding the vault from the offline backup, which is protected by a passphrase maintained by the platform team. The current recovery passphrase is listed directly below this paragraph.

unlock words, taguf-kagup: ralix-wenael